Golden times

The old wear a mask that most never try to peel away. All that is seen is the wrinkles, the stoop, the arthritic hands and fading memories. No recognition of the past, the fights against racism, the battles with the elements and the war waged against workers by a ravaged economy. Elder is a position of respect in many cultures, but in the ‘civilized western world' elder is just a concept that is paid lip service.
